Leads are potential buyers, newsletter subscribers, or event participants — it depends on the marketing objectives. The main thing is that the lead should share their contacts with the company. Lead generation is the process of attracting leads.
What types of leads are there?
Leads are divided into qualified and unqualified, hot, warm and cold.
Qualified leads are potential customers who have shown interest in a product or service and meet the criteria of the target audience. They are ready for further interaction and are highly likely to make a purchase.
Unqualified leads are contacts that have not been screened for compliance with the target audience. They may be random or not interested in the product, which reduces the likelihood of conversion.

Cold leads are potential customers who have not shown instagram data interest in a product or service. They may not be familiar with the company. It takes significant effort to engage such an audience.
Warm leads are contacts who have shown some interest but are not yet ready to buy. They need additional information or persuasion.
Hot leads are potential customers who are actively interested in the product and are ready to buy in the near future. They have already interacted with the company and may be at the decision-making stage.

How to Attract Leads: Lead Generation Methods
Depending on the target audience and campaign budget, there are several lead generation methods you can use:
Contextual advertising - attract interested users through ads in search engines and on sites that match their interests.
SEO optimization (from English Search Engine Optimization, search engine optimization) - adapt the site for search engines so that it occupies high positions in search results, attract organic traffic (that is, those users who come to the site from search results, and not through an advertisement) and increase the visibility of the company on the Internet.
Email Marketing - Send emails to potential or existing customers with information about products, promotions and other interesting offers, keep in touch with existing customers and attract new ones.
Social Media – Engage potential customers and stay connected with current ones.
Affiliate Marketing - Partner with other companies or bloggers who promote products or services for a fee.
Referral Marketing - Invite existing customers to spread the word about your business in exchange for a gift.
Offline Events – Organize conferences, exhibitions, seminars and other events where you can present your products or services to potential customers.
